In all our work, we are called to serve as unto the Lord. As it is written in Colossians 3:23-24 WEB, Whatever you do, work heartily, as for the Lord, and not for men, knowing that from the Lord you will receive the inheritance as your reward. You serve the Lord Christ.
However, it is also important to ensure that we are treated fairly and justly. In 1 Corinthians 9:7-9 WEB, Paul asks, Who plants a vineyard, and doesn't eat of its fruit? Or who feeds a flock, and doesn't drink from the flock's milk? Do I speak these things according to the ways of men? Or doesn't the law also say the same thing? For it is written in the law of Moses, "You shall not muzzle an ox while it treads out the grain." Is it for the oxen that God cares, or does he say it assuredly for our sakes? Yes, for our sakes it was written.
In this spirit, it is reasonable to discuss these changes in job scope with your employer. Open communication is key in any relationship, including the workplace. Proverbs 15:22 WEB tells us, Without consultation, plans are frustrated, but with many counselors they succeed.
